Word: rationale

Definition: fundamental reason or principle (on which a system or principle is based); fundamental reason or justification; grounds for an action

::: carillon - a set of bells (often in a tower) capable of being played
::: dingy - (of things and place) dirty and dull; Ex. dingy street/curtain
::: guffaw - boisterous laughter; V.
::: quiescent - dormant; temporarily inactive; at rest; N. quiescence
::: impropriety - improperness; unsuitableness
::: demolition - destruction; V. demolish
::: engross - occupy fully; absorb
::: irksome - annoying; tedious; V. irk: annoy
::: murky - dark and gloomy; thick with fog; vague; Ex. murky night/fog; N. murk: partial or complete darkness; gloom
::: pedigree - line of ancestors; ancestry; lineage; ADJ. (of an animal) descended from of a chosen family; Ex. pedigree dog; CF. crane's foot
